Output 84d8b557d25db335d1915f2e5a23d3bc152c781ea7917554298dc2bbc639b564:1

value
39153814
script pubkey
OP_0 OP_PUSHBYTES_20 8ef40c8618511ad50e13e4795d2ba60546730ac2
address
bc1q3m6qepsc2ydd2rsnu3u462axq4r8xzkzfsmsaj
transaction
84d8b557d25db335d1915f2e5a23d3bc152c781ea7917554298dc2bbc639b564
spent
true